<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>15977</bug_id>
          
          <creation_ts>2007-11-13 22:09:34 -0800</creation_ts>
          <short_desc>match firefox&apos;s preference for resizing images</short_desc>
          <delta_ts>2010-06-10 15:50:07 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Images</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Mac</rep_platform>
          <op_sys>OS X 10.4</op_sys>
          <bug_status>UNCONFIRMED</bug_status>
          <resolution></res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>0</everconfirmed>
          <reporter name="rahul abrol">solushex</reporter>
          <assigned_to name="Nobody">webkit-unassigned</assigned_to>
          <cc>andersca</cc>
    
    <cc>mrowe</cc>
    
    <cc>webkit</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>61168</commentid>
    <comment_count>0</comment_count>
    <who name="rahul abrol">solushex</who>
    <bug_when>2007-11-13 22:09:34 -0800</bug_when>
    <thetext>WebKitShrinksStandaloneImagesToFitKey (from bug 5400) is an all or none preference; setting it to 0 removes resizing altogether.

i suggest matching firefox&apos;s behavior, where the pref. controls whether the image is resized by default, but the option to resize via left-click is always present.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>61169</commentid>
    <comment_count>1</comment_count>
      <attachid>17257</attachid>
    <who name="rahul abrol">solushex</who>
    <bug_when>2007-11-13 22:13:10 -0800</bug_when>
    <thetext>Created attachment 17257
patch v1

simple patch.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>61184</commentid>
    <comment_count>2</comment_count>
    <who name="Mark Rowe (bdash)">mrowe</who>
    <bug_when>2007-11-13 23:23:13 -0800</bug_when>
    <thetext>Can you please fill in the ChangeLog rather than leaving it empty.  Name, email address and a description of the change is required.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>61191</commentid>
    <comment_count>3</comment_count>
      <attachid>17264</attachid>
    <who name="rahul abrol">solushex</who>
    <bug_when>2007-11-14 00:50:32 -0800</bug_when>
    <thetext>Created attachment 17264
patch v1 w/better changelog</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>61665</commentid>
    <comment_count>4</comment_count>
    <who name="Mark Rowe (bdash)">mrowe</who>
    <bug_when>2007-11-19 05:44:14 -0800</bug_when>
    <thetext>Landed in r27903.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>61720</commentid>
    <comment_count>5</comment_count>
    <who name="rahul abrol">solushex</who>
    <bug_when>2007-11-19 16:08:21 -0800</bug_when>
    <thetext>i can&apos;t verify this.  safari 3.0.4 calls setShrinksStandaloneImagesToFit: which sets WebKitShrinksStandaloneImagesToFitKey to 1 on launch regardless of its previous value.

i don&apos;t understand this.  is setShrinksStandaloneImagesToFit: getting called with no parameter?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>74448</commentid>
    <comment_count>6</comment_count>
    <who name="rahul abrol">solushex</who>
    <bug_when>2008-03-19 10:08:29 -0700</bug_when>
    <thetext>r28200 undid this patch.
http://trac.webkit.org/projects/webkit/changeset/28200

if this was intentional, then &quot;fixed&quot; is the wrong resolution.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>74827</commentid>
    <comment_count>7</comment_count>
      <attachid>17264</attachid>
    <who name="Mark Rowe (bdash)">mrowe</who>
    <bug_when>2008-03-22 15:22:29 -0700</bug_when>
    <thetext>Comment on attachment 17264
patch v1 w/better changelog

Clearing review flag since the patch was landed.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>74828</commentid>
    <comment_count>8</comment_count>
    <who name="Mark Rowe (bdash)">mrowe</who>
    <bug_when>2008-03-22 15:23:38 -0700</bug_when>
    <thetext>Anders, can you comment on why &lt;http://trac.webkit.org/projects/webkit/changeset/28200&gt; reverted this behaviour?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>74976</commentid>
    <comment_count>9</comment_count>
    <who name="Anders Carlsson">andersca</who>
    <bug_when>2008-03-24 09:11:46 -0700</bug_when>
    <thetext>Because of backwards compatibility. There might be apps that rely on images not being autoresized, which is why we added the preference in the first place.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>87175</commentid>
    <comment_count>10</comment_count>
    <who name="Robert Blaut">webkit</who>
    <bug_when>2008-07-28 11:10:19 -0700</bug_when>
    <thetext>(In reply to comment #9)
&gt; Because of backwards compatibility. There might be apps that rely on images not
&gt; being autoresized, which is why we added the preference in the first place.
&gt; 

So, is it impossible to fix the bug? If yes, it should be marked as WONTFIX.</thetext>
  </long_desc>
      
          <attachment
              isobsolete="1"
              ispatch="1"
              isprivate="0"
          >
            <attachid>17257</attachid>
            <date>2007-11-13 22:13:10 -0800</date>
            <delta_ts>2007-11-14 00:50:32 -0800</delta_ts>
            <desc>patch v1</desc>
            <filename>patch.txt</filename>
            <type>text/plain</type>
            <size>1582</size>
            <attacher name="rahul abrol">solushex</attacher>
            
              <data encoding="base64">SW5kZXg6IENoYW5nZUxvZwo9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09Ci0tLSBDaGFuZ2VMb2cJKHJldmlzaW9uIDI3Nzgy
KQorKysgQ2hhbmdlTG9nCSh3b3JraW5nIGNvcHkpCkBAIC0xLDMgKzEsMTggQEAKKzIwMDctMTEt
MTMgIHJhaHVsICA8c2V0IEVNQUlMX0FERFJFU1MgZW52aXJvbm1lbnQgdmFyaWFibGU+CisKKyAg
ICAgICAgUmV2aWV3ZWQgYn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gV0FSTklORzogTk8g
VEVTVCBDQVNFUyBBRERFRCBPUiBDSEFOR0VECisKKyAgICAgICAgKiBsb2FkZXIvSW1hZ2VEb2N1
bWVudC5jcHA6CisgICAgICAgIChXZWJDb3JlOjpJbWFnZURvY3VtZW50OjpJbWFnZURvY3VtZW50
KToKKyAgICAgICAgKFdlYkNvcmU6OkltYWdlRG9jdW1lbnQ6OmNyZWF0ZURvY3VtZW50U3RydWN0
dXJlKToKKyAgICAgICAgKFdlYkNvcmU6OkltYWdlRG9jdW1lbnQ6OmltYWdlQ2hhbmdlZCk6CisK
IDIwMDctMTEtMTMgIE9saXZlciBIdW50ICA8b2xpdmVyQGFwcGxlLmNvbT4KIAogICAgICAgICBS
ZXZpZXdlZCBieSBBbmRlcnMuCkluZGV4OiBsb2FkZXIvSW1hZ2VEb2N1bWVudC5jcHAKPT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PQotLS0gbG9hZGVyL0ltYWdlRG9jdW1lbnQuY3BwCShyZXZpc2lvbiAyNzY4MCkKKysrIGxv
YWRlci9JbWFnZURvY3VtZW50LmNwcAkod29ya2luZyBjb3B5KQpAQCAtMTI4LDcgKzEyOCw3IEBA
IEltYWdlRG9jdW1lbnQ6OkltYWdlRG9jdW1lbnQoRE9NSW1wbGVtZW4KICAgICAsIG1faW1hZ2VF
bGVtZW50KDApCiAgICAgLCBtX2ltYWdlU2l6ZUlzS25vd24oZmFsc2UpCiAgICAgLCBtX2RpZFNo
cmlua0ltYWdlKGZhbHNlKQotICAgICwgbV9zaG91bGRTaHJpbmtJbWFnZSh0cnVlKQorICAgICwg
bV9zaG91bGRTaHJpbmtJbWFnZShzaG91bGRTaHJpbmtUb0ZpdCgpKQogewogICAgIHNldFBhcnNl
TW9kZShDb21wYXQpOwogfQpAQCAtMTU5LDkgKzE1OSw2IEBAIHZvaWQgSW1hZ2VEb2N1bWVudDo6
Y3JlYXRlRG9jdW1lbnRTdHJ1Y3QKICAgICAKICAgICBib2R5LT5hcHBlbmRDaGlsZChpbWFnZUVs
ZW1lbnQsIGVjKTsKICAgICAKLSAgICBpZiAoIXNob3VsZFNocmlua1RvRml0KCkpCi0gICAgICAg
IHJldHVybjsKLSAgICAKICAgICAvLyBBZGQgZXZlbnQgbGlzdGVuZXJzCiAgICAgUmVmUHRyPEV2
ZW50TGlzdGVuZXI+IGxpc3RlbmVyID0gbmV3IEltYWdlRXZlbnRMaXN0ZW5lcih0aGlzKTsKICAg
ICBhZGRXaW5kb3dFdmVudExpc3RlbmVyKCJyZXNpemUiLCBsaXN0ZW5lciwgZmFsc2UpOwpAQCAt
MjI2LDkgKzIyMyw2IEBAIHZvaWQgSW1hZ2VEb2N1bWVudDo6aW1hZ2VDaGFuZ2VkKCkKICAgICAK
ICAgICBtX2ltYWdlU2l6ZUlzS25vd24gPSB0cnVlOwogICAgIAotICAgIGlmICghc2hvdWxkU2hy
aW5rVG9GaXQoKSkKLSAgICAgICAgcmV0dXJuOwotICAgIAogICAgIC8vIEZvcmNlIHJlc2l6aW5n
IG9mIHRoZSBpbWFnZQogICAgIHdpbmRvd1NpemVDaGFuZ2VkKCk7CiB9Cg==
</data>

          </attachment>
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>17264</attachid>
            <date>2007-11-14 00:50:32 -0800</date>
            <delta_ts>2010-06-10 15:50:07 -0700</delta_ts>
            <desc>patch v1 w/better changelog</desc>
            <filename>patch.txt</filename>
            <type>text/plain</type>
            <size>1641</size>
            <attacher name="rahul abrol">solushex</attacher>
            
              <data encoding="base64">SW5kZXg6IENoYW5nZUxvZwo9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09Ci0tLSBDaGFuZ2VMb2cJKHJldmlzaW9uIDI3Nzgy
KQorKysgQ2hhbmdlTG9nCSh3b3JraW5nIGNvcHkpCkBAIC0xLDMgKzEsMTggQEAKKzIwMDctMTEt
MTMgIFJhaHVsIEFicm9sICA8cmE1dWxAY29tY2FzdC5uZXQ+CisKKyAgICAgICAgUmV2aWV3ZWQg
Yn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gaHR0cDovL2J1Z3Mud2Via2l0Lm9yZy9zaG93
X2J1Zy5jZ2k/aWQ9MTU5NzcKKyAgICAgICAgUmVzaXppbmcgaW1hZ2VzIHByZWZlcmVuY2Ugbm93
IHRvZ2dsZXMgZGVmYXVsdCBpbWFnZSBzdGF0ZS4KKworICAgICAgICAqIGxvYWRlci9JbWFnZURv
Y3VtZW50LmNwcDoKKyAgICAgICAgKFdlYkNvcmU6OkltYWdlRG9jdW1lbnQ6OkltYWdlRG9jdW1l
bnQpOgorICAgICAgICAoV2ViQ29yZTo6SW1hZ2VEb2N1bWVudDo6Y3JlYXRlRG9jdW1lbnRTdHJ1
Y3R1cmUpOgorICAgICAgICAoV2ViQ29yZTo6SW1hZ2VEb2N1bWVudDo6aW1hZ2VDaGFuZ2VkKToK
KwogMjAwNy0xMS0xMyAgT2xpdmVyIEh1bnQgIDxvbGl2ZXJAYXBwbGUuY29tPgogCiAgICAgICAg
IFJldmlld2VkIGJ5IEFuZGVycy4KSW5kZXg6IGxvYWRlci9JbWFnZURvY3VtZW50LmNwcAo9P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09Ci0tLSBsb2FkZXIvSW1hZ2VEb2N1bWVudC5jcHAJKHJldmlzaW9uIDI3NjgwKQorKysg
bG9hZGVyL0ltYWdlRG9jdW1lbnQuY3BwCSh3b3JraW5nIGNvcHkpCkBAIC0xMjgsNyArMTI4LDcg
QEAgSW1hZ2VEb2N1bWVudDo6SW1hZ2VEb2N1bWVudChET01JbXBsZW1lbgogICAgICwgbV9pbWFn
ZUVsZW1lbnQoMCkKICAgICAsIG1faW1hZ2VTaXplSXNLbm93bihmYWxzZSkKICAgICAsIG1fZGlk
U2hyaW5rSW1hZ2UoZmFsc2UpCi0gICAgLCBtX3Nob3VsZFNocmlua0ltYWdlKHRydWUpCisgICAg
LCBtX3Nob3VsZFNocmlua0ltYWdlKHNob3VsZFNocmlua1RvRml0KCkpCiB7CiAgICAgc2V0UGFy
c2VNb2RlKENvbXBhdCk7CiB9CkBAIC0xNTksOSArMTU5LDYgQEAgdm9pZCBJbWFnZURvY3VtZW50
OjpjcmVhdGVEb2N1bWVudFN0cnVjdAogICAgIAogICAgIGJvZHktPmFwcGVuZENoaWxkKGltYWdl
RWxlbWVudCwgZWMpOwogICAgIAotICAgIGlmICghc2hvdWxkU2hyaW5rVG9GaXQoKSkKLSAgICAg
ICAgcmV0dXJuOwotICAgIAogICAgIC8vIEFkZCBldmVudCBsaXN0ZW5lcnMKICAgICBSZWZQdHI8
RXZlbnRMaXN0ZW5lcj4gbGlzdGVuZXIgPSBuZXcgSW1hZ2VFdmVudExpc3RlbmVyKHRoaXMpOwog
ICAgIGFkZFdpbmRvd0V2ZW50TGlzdGVuZXIoInJlc2l6ZSIsIGxpc3RlbmVyLCBmYWxzZSk7CkBA
IC0yMjYsOSArMjIzLDYgQEAgdm9pZCBJbWFnZURvY3VtZW50OjppbWFnZUNoYW5nZWQoKQogICAg
IAogICAgIG1faW1hZ2VTaXplSXNLbm93biA9IHRydWU7CiAgICAgCi0gICAgaWYgKCFzaG91bGRT
aHJpbmtUb0ZpdCgpKQotICAgICAgICByZXR1cm47Ci0gICAgCiAgICAgLy8gRm9yY2UgcmVzaXpp
bmcgb2YgdGhlIGltYWdlCiAgICAgd2luZG93U2l6ZUNoYW5nZWQoKTsKIH0K
</data>

          </attachment>
      

    </bug>

</bugzilla>